@charset "utf-8";

.phone_list {font-size:0;margin:0;padding:0;}
.phone_list > li {font-size:12px;display:inline-block;vertical-align:middle;width:33.3%;}
.phone_list > li > div {width:auto;}
.phone_list > li:nth-child(1) > div {padding-right:10px;}
.phone_list > li:nth-child(2) > div {width:auto;}
.phone_list > li:nth-child(3) > div {padding-left:10px;}

.Real [class*='link'] {cursor:pointer;}
.Real [class*='layer'] {position:absolute;z-index:1;}
.Real [class*='section'] {position:relative;overflow:hidden;}
.Real [class*='section'] .content {width:1255px;margin:0 auto;padding:0;}
.Real [class*='section'] .visible {overflow:visible;}
.Real [class*='food'] {overflow:hidden;}
.Real [class*='food'] img {max-width:80%;}

.Real #conPC {position:relative;top:184;left:0;width:100%;opacity:1;visibility:visible;transition:all .6s cubic-bezier(0.785, 0.135, 0.15, 0.86);-webkit-transition:all .6s cubic-bezier(0.785, 0.135, 0.15, 0.86);z-index:1;}
.Real #conMOBILE {position:fixed;top:0;left:0;right:100%;width:100%;opacity:0;visibility:hidden;transition:all .6s cubic-bezier(0.785, 0.135, 0.15, 0.86);-webkit-transition:all .6s cubic-bezier(0.785, 0.135, 0.15, 0.86);z-index:-1;}


/*** [Pc] --/start/-- ***/

.Real #conPC .fixedbar {position:fixed;left:0;width:100%;height:200px;z-index:100;background:url('https://i0.wp.com/zerotoonemedia.com/zto_letter/img/land_fix.jpg') center top no-repeat;transition:all .35s cubic-bezier(0.785, 0.135, 0.15, 0.86);-webkit-transition:all .35s cubic-bezier(0.785, 0.135, 0.15, 0.86);}
.Real #conPC .fixedbar.top {top:0px;}
.Real #conPC .fixedbar.top.hidden {top:-100%;}
.Real #conPC .fixedbar.bottom {bottom:-60;}
.Real #conPC .fixedbar.bottom.hidden {bottom:-100%;}
.Real #conPC .fixedbar > div {width:2000px;margin:0 auto;padding:0;position:absolute;top:40%;left:50%;transform:translate(-50%,-50%);}
/*.Real #conPC .fixedbar > div .layerbtn01 {top:180%;right:300px;transform:translateY(-50%);width:200px;height:200px;}*/
.Real #conPC .fixedbar > div .layerbtn02 {top:15px;right:570px;transform:translateY(-50%);width:285px;height:80px;}

/* 원본 */
/*.Real #conPC .fixedbar > div .layerbtn01 {top:180%;right:300px;transform:translateY(-50%);width:600px;height:150px;}
.Real #conPC .fixedbar > div .layerbtn02 {top:50%;right:45px;transform:translateY(-50%);width:190px;height:60px;}

.Real .floatMenu {position:absolute;top:630px;right:50%;transform:translateX(50%);max-width:1800px;width:100%;height:1px;z-index:50;}
.Real .floatMenu .side_db {position:absolute;top:0;right:0;width:164px;}*/

.Real #conPC .section01 {background: url('https://i0.wp.com/zerotoonemedia.com/zto_letter/img/land_main.jpg') center top no-repeat;transition:all}
.Real #conPC .section01 .content {height:6300px;}
/*.Real #conPC .section01 > div {width:1256px;margin:0 auto;padding:0;position:absolute;transform:translate(-50%,-50%);}*/
.Real #conPC .section01 > div .layerbtn01 {position:relative;top:465px;left:255px;}
.Real #conPC .section01 > div .layerbtn03 {position:relative;top:5950px;left:255px;} /*right:680px width:180px;height:180px;*/
/*.Real #conPC .section01 > div .layerlink01 { bottom:48px;right:38%;font-size:36px;font-weight:900;width:385px;height:74px;} transform:translateX(-50%);*/

/*top:4388px,  772px*/

/*.Real #conPC .section01 .layerbtn01 {top:92%;left:50%;transform:translateX(-50%);background:#FF0016;color:#fff;font-size:36px;font-weight:900;padding:38px;}
.Real #conPC .section01 .layerbtn01 .arrow {display:inline-block;vertical-align:middle;position:relative;width:40px;height:40px;margin-left:20px;}
.Real #conPC .section01 .layerbtn01 .arrow::after {content:'';display:block;width:70%;height:70%;border-right:5px solid #fff;border-bottom:5px solid #fff;position:absolute;top:50%;right:0%;transform:translate(-50%,-50%) rotate(-45deg);}*/
/*.Real #conPC .section02 {background:url('../img/section02.jpg') center top no-repeat;}
.Real #conPC .section02 .content {height:797px;}
.Real #conPC .section03 {background:url('../img/section03.jpg') center top no-repeat;}
.Real #conPC .section03 .content {height:1473px;}
.Real #conPC .section03 .layerbtn01 {top:84%;left:50%;transform:translateX(-50%);background:#FF0016;color:#fff;font-size:36px;font-weight:900;padding:38px;}
.Real #conPC .section03 .layerbtn01 .arrow {display:inline-block;vertical-align:middle;position:relative;width:40px;height:40px;margin-left:20px;}
.Real #conPC .section03 .layerbtn01 .arrow::after {content:'';display:block;width:70%;height:70%;border-right:5px solid #fff;border-bottom:5px solid #fff;position:absolute;top:50%;right:0%;transform:translate(-50%,-50%) rotate(-45deg);}
.Real #conPC .section04 {background:url('../img/section04.jpg') center top no-repeat;}
.Real #conPC .section04 .content {height:1198px;}
.Real #conPC .section04 .layerbtn01 {top:87%;left:50%;transform:translateX(-50%);background:#FF0016;color:#fff;font-size:36px;font-weight:900;padding:38px;}
.Real #conPC .section04 .layerbtn01 .arrow {display:inline-block;vertical-align:middle;position:relative;width:40px;height:40px;margin-left:20px;}
.Real #conPC .section04 .layerbtn01 .arrow::after {content:'';display:block;width:70%;height:70%;border-right:5px solid #fff;border-bottom:5px solid #fff;position:absolute;top:50%;right:0%;transform:translate(-50%,-50%) rotate(-45deg);}
.Real #conPC .section05 {background:url('../img/section05.jpg') center top no-repeat;}
.Real #conPC .section05 .content {height:1726px;}
.Real #conPC .section05 .layerbtn01 {top:92%;left:50%;transform:translateX(-50%);background:#FF0016;color:#fff;font-size:36px;font-weight:900;padding:38px;}
.Real #conPC .section05 .layerbtn01 .arrow {display:inline-block;vertical-align:middle;position:relative;width:40px;height:40px;margin-left:20px;}
.Real #conPC .section05 .layerbtn01 .arrow::after {content:'';display:block;width:70%;height:70%;border-right:5px solid #fff;border-bottom:5px solid #fff;position:absolute;top:50%;right:0%;transform:translate(-50%,-50%) rotate(-45deg);}
.Real #conPC .section06 {background:url('../img/section06.jpg') center top no-repeat;}
.Real #conPC .section06 .content {height:1098px;}
*.Real #conPC .section06 .layerlink01 {left:50%;top:82%;transform:translateX(-50%);width:410px;height:100%;}*/
.Real #conPC .section07 {background:url('https://i0.wp.com/zerotoonemedia.com/zto_letter/img/section07.jpg') center top no-repeat;}
.Real #conPC .section07 .content {height:100px;}


/*** [Pc] --/end/-- ***/


/*** [Mobile] --/start/-- ***/
.Real #conMOBILE img {width:100%;}
.Real #conMOBILE .fixedbar {position:fixed;left:0;width:100%;z-index:100;transition:all .35s cubic-bezier(0.785, 0.135, 0.15, 0.86);-webkit-transition:all .35s cubic-bezier(0.785, 0.135, 0.15, 0.86);}
.Real #conMOBILE .fixedbar.bottom {bottom:0;}
.Real #conMOBILE .fixedbar.bottom.hidden {transform:translateY(120%);}
.Real #conMOBILE .fixedbar.top {top:0;}
.Real #conMOBILE .fixedbar.top.hidden {transform:translateY(-120%);}
.Real #conMOBILE .fixedbar .layerlink01 {left:0;bottom:0;width:50%;height:100%;}
.Real #conMOBILE .fixedbar .layerlink02 {right:0%;bottom:0;width:100%;height:100%;}
/* .Real #conMOBILE .fixedbar .layerlink01 {left:0;bottom:0;width:40.6%;height:100%;}
.Real #conMOBILE .fixedbar .layerlink02 {left:40.6%;bottom:0;width:40.6%;height:100%;}
.Real #conMOBILE .fixedbar .layerlink03 {right:0;bottom:0;width:18.8%;height:100%;} */





.Real #conMOBILE img {width:100%;}
.Real #conMOBILE [class*="section"]{text-align:center;}
.Real #conMOBILE .section01 {}
.Real #conMOBILE .section01 .layerbtn01 {bottom:10%;left:50%;transform:translateX(-50%);width:70%;background:#FF0016;color:#fff;font-size:6vw;font-weight:900;padding:5vw 2vw;}
/*.Real #conMOBILE .section02 {}
.Real #conMOBILE .section03 {}
.Real #conMOBILE .section03 .layerbtn01 {bottom:5%;left:50%;transform:translateX(-50%);width:70%;background:#FF0016;color:#fff;font-size:6vw;font-weight:900;padding:5vw 2vw;}
.Real #conMOBILE .section04 {}
.Real #conMOBILE .section04 .layerbtn01 {bottom:2.5%;left:50%;transform:translateX(-50%);width:70%;background:#FF0016;color:#fff;font-size:6vw;font-weight:900;padding:5vw 2vw;}
.Real #conMOBILE .section05 {}
.Real #conMOBILE .section05 .layerbtn01 {bottom:3%;left:50%;transform:translateX(-50%);width:70%;background:#FF0016;color:#fff;font-size:6vw;font-weight:900;padding:5vw 2vw;}
.Real #conMOBILE .section06 {}
.Real #conMOBILE .section06 .layerbtn01 {bottom:3%;left:50%;transform:translateX(-50%);width:70%;background:#FF0016;color:#fff;font-size:6vw;font-weight:900;padding:5vw 2vw;}*/
.Real #conMOBILE .section07 {background:url('https://i0.wp.com/zerotoonemedia.com/zto_letter/img/m/section07.jpg') center top / 100% no-repeat;}
/*.Real #conMOBILE .section07 .footer {}
.Real #conMOBILE .section07 footer {color:#777;font-size:2.4vw;line-height:1.6;padding-bottom:2vw;margin-top:13vw;}
.Real #conMOBILE .section07 h3 {color:#777;font-size:3vw;line-height:1.6;font-weight:700;}  padding:2vw 1vw;*/


/*** [Mobile] --/end/-- ***/

@media screen and (max-width: 1100px) {
	.Real #conPC {position:fixed;top:0;left:0;right:100%;width:100%;opacity:0;visibility:hidden;transition:all .6s cubic-bezier(0.785, 0.135, 0.15, 0.86);-webkit-transition:all .6s cubic-bezier(0.785, 0.135, 0.15, 0.86);z-index:-1;}
	.Real #conMOBILE {position:relative;top:0;left:0;width:100%;opacity:1;visibility:visible;transition:all .6s cubic-bezier(0.785, 0.135, 0.15, 0.86);-webkit-transition:all .6s cubic-bezier(0.785, 0.135, 0.15, 0.86);z-index:1;}	
	.Real .floatMenu {top:80%;}
	.Real .floatMenu .side_db {width:30%;right:10px;}
	.Real .floatMenu .side_db img {width:100%;}
}

@media (orientation:landscape){
	.Real #conMOBILE .fixedbar {max-width: 460px;margin:0 auto;left:50%;transform:translateX(-50%);}
}


